How big is a W-14?

A W-14 is 103.0 in (2,616 mm) long, 50.0 in (1,270 mm) wide and 48.0 in (1,219 mm) tall.

How much does a W-14 weigh?

A W-14 weighs 2,899 lb (1,315 kg) unballasted.
